On Sunday, Faye Townsend worked overtime as usual. Declan Rivers went on a blind date in the morning and couldn’t come to work.

In the afternoon, he came with the latest news to report to her.

When he entered the room, his expression was somewhat urgent: "Director Townsend, things have taken a turn for the worse. I just received news that Deputy Director Townsend has been arrested in Malaysia."

"Why was he arrested?"

"It’s said that he’s been harassing a Malaysian-Chinese tycoon for several days in a row.

The tycoon couldn’t bear the harassment, so he reported it to the police.

By the time I got the news, Deputy Director Townsend had already spent two nights in the local police station."

Faye Townsend pondered for a moment: "Declan, put down what you’re doing now, take two lawyers with you to Malaysia. Regardless of any other objective, you must bring my brother back. If there’s any issue, call me at any time—I’ll find someone here to help you solve it. Depart this afternoon."

"Understood, Director Townsend. I’ll go prepare right away."

After Declan Rivers left, Faye Townsend pulled open the drawer and took out the family portrait that she had thrown in there.

She murmured softly, looking at Richard Townsend in the photo: "What on earth did you go to do? What do you want from Walter Hansen? I’m really confused by you."

This whole afternoon, Faye Townsend was extremely worried about Richard Townsend’s situation.

Just after six o’clock, she left the company and arrived at the underground parking lot. As she was about to open her car door, the door of a black Mercedes SUV on the right opened, and Lucas Warren appeared in front of her without any warning.

Seeing Lucas Warren here, Faye Townsend’s instincts made her tense up for a moment, as her hand was poised to open the car door to get inside.

In the instant she was about to open the door, Lucas Warren had already used his position at the passenger side to pull open her car door and sit down inside.

Now, Faye Townsend found herself in a dilemma standing by the door.

"What do you want?" Faye Townsend looked at him displeased.

"It just seemed like you’re in a hurry, so I thought I’d come in and save you some time. Where do you want to go? Let’s head out."

Faye Townsend pressed her lips together in irritation: "Where I’m going is none of your business. Why are you getting into my car?"

"Because I have something to give you, and also a few words to say to you."

Faye Townsend scoffed coldly: "But I have nothing to say to you, so get out now."

"It’s not that easy. Now you have two choices.

First, get in the car, drive to wherever you want to go, and I will leave when we reach the destination.

Second, leave and take a taxi, but I will also follow you out.

You know, I’m the type who won’t give up until I achieve my goal, otherwise I wouldn’t be here waiting for you until six o’clock."

Faye Townsend stared at him without saying a word or moving.

If possible, she really wanted to lock him in the car and let him suffocate to death.

"You’re staring at me like this... what, are you scared of me?

You should be scared indeed, because what I’m going to give you is no ordinary thing. Perhaps, Hunter Warren is going to be doomed."

Faye Townsend snorted and sat in the car; she wasn’t influenced by his provocation.

She indeed knew his tenacious character of not giving up until he reaches his goal.

It seems to be a common trait among the Warren Family members.

She isn’t someone who likes to endure prolonged battles, since usually being stubborn to the end only leads to a lose-lose situation and a waste of resources.

So why not be sensible from the start?

Besides, she truly wanted to know what Lucas Warren had up his sleeve.

Considering his confident demeanor, he must have a backup plan.

Instead of letting him backstab Hunter, it’s better to be prepared from the start.

After closing the car door, she felt much more composed, started the vehicle, and drove off.

The only thing that made her feel uneasy and caused her palms to sweat was the gaze of Lucas Warren, who kept staring at her from the passenger seat.

His sight was fixated as if it were locked on her, unwavering from beginning to end.

"This time, I am determined to have you, you have no other choice.

Faye Townsend, I’m not getting any younger, and I don’t want to keep dragging this on.

So are you planning to end your relationship with Hunter by yourself, or... should I take action?

I am ready at any moment to cast him into hell."

Just as Faye Townsend’s car reached the middle of the road, his words threw her into disarray, and she stomped on the brakes.

Lucas Warren’s hand slightly steadied himself on the dashboard in front, but his gaze did not shift in the slightest.
